A Solemn April Afternoon: Reflections on Sacrifice and Redemption
"Tarde de Abril" by Duo Libano is a poignant reflection on the crucifixion of Jesus Christ, capturing the emotional and spiritual weight of that historical event. The song vividly describes the scene of Jesus's death, emphasizing the profound impact it had on those who witnessed it. The lyrics evoke a sense of reverence and sorrow, as they recount the natural phenomena that accompanied the crucifixion, such as the earth trembling and the sun darkening, symbolizing the magnitude of the moment.
The song delves into the themes of sacrifice and redemption, highlighting Jesus's willingness to die for the sins of humanity. The lyrics underscore the personal responsibility of individuals, as they acknowledge that Jesus's death was for "your fault and mine." This personal connection to the event invites listeners to reflect on their own lives and the significance of Jesus's sacrifice. The mention of Mary weeping at the foot of the cross adds a layer of human emotion, illustrating the deep sorrow and loss felt by those closest to Jesus.
Furthermore, the song captures the realization of Jesus's divine nature, as expressed by the centurion who declares, "truly this was the Son of God." This acknowledgment serves as a turning point, where the truth of Jesus's identity is recognized even by those who were initially skeptical. The imagery of the crowd beating their chests in remorse signifies a collective acknowledgment of guilt and a desire for redemption. "Tarde de Abril" thus serves as a powerful reminder of the transformative power of faith and the enduring impact of Jesus's sacrifice on humanity.
